It’s not a show without animals and there are plenty to be seen, judged, patted and even ridden at the Waroona Show.
At the North end of the grounds when you enter from Millar Street or the Southwestern Highway, you will find the Poultry Shed with chickens, geese, ducks or all shapes and sizes. From there heading east there are Alpacas, Cattle including some really cute calves, sheep and the Lions Animal Nursery. If you are lucky you will also find the sheep dogs herding sheep through the crowd. On the oval starting at 8 in the morning, the horse events will be in action and in the afternoon you will be able to see the show jumping and 6 Bar Jumping events. For the little ones there are also pony rides.
